Who We Are

Property Asset Care was founded with a clear purpose: to provide reliable, trustworthy property maintenance for those who need it most — vulnerable individuals who can no longer look after their homes themselves.

We work primarily with solicitors who have been appointed as Court of Protection deputies. These legal professionals carry a significant responsibility to protect and maintain properties on behalf of their clients, and they need a dependable partner to handle the practical side.

That partner is us. From securing a vacant property on day one to arranging valuations and carrying out ongoing maintenance, we provide a complete property care service that deputies can rely on.
